Las Vegas (LAS) to Poplar Bluff (POF)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Harry Reid International Airport (LAS) in Las Vegas, United States to Poplar Bluff Regional Business Airport (POF) in Poplar Bluff, United States is 2,217 kilometers (1,377 miles / 1,197 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 4h, flying east at a heading of 81°.
